Edgar allan poe launched the detective story in 1841, as a highbrow form of entertainment, a puzzle to be solved by a rational sifting of clues. American crime story is an american anthology true crime television series developed by scott alexander and larry karaszewski, who are executive producers with brad falchuk, nina jacobson, ryan murphy, and brad simpson.
